Ingredients
Gather the following ingredients:
Soup Ingredients
- 1 lb chicken breast, sliced
- 1 can coconut milk
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 2 stalks lemongrass, chopped
- 3-4 kaffir lime leaves
- 1 inch ginger, sliced
- 2-3 Thai chilies, chopped
- 2 cups mushrooms, sliced
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1 tablespoon fish sauce
- Juice of 1 lime
- Fresh cilantro, for garnish
Make sure to have all the ingredients ready before you start cooking.
Instructions
Follow these steps to make your Thai Chicken Soup:
Prepare the Broth
In a large pot, combine chicken broth, coconut milk, lemongrass, lime leaves, ginger, and Thai chilies. Bring to a boil over medium heat.
Cook the Chicken
Add the sliced chicken to the pot and simmer for about 10 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through.
Add Vegetables
Stir in the mushrooms and cherry tomatoes, and cook for another 5 minutes until the vegetables are tender.
Season the Soup
Add fish sauce and lime juice to taste. Adjust the seasoning as needed.
Serve
Ladle the soup into bowls and garnish with fresh cilantro before serving.

Tips for Perfecting Your Soup
To ensure your Thai Chicken Soup turns out perfectly every time, make sure to use fresh ingredients. Fresh herbs and spices are key to achieving that authentic Thai flavor, so don't substitute with dried versions if possible. Additionally, when preparing the chicken, slice it into thin pieces to promote even cooking and tenderness in the broth.
Consider preparing a larger batch of the soup, as it tastes even better the next day! The flavors meld beautifully overnight, making it a fantastic option for meal prep or a quick lunch. Just reheat gently on the stove, adding a splash of broth or coconut milk if needed to restore its creamy consistency.

Questions About Recipes
→ Can I use leftover chicken for this recipe?
Yes, leftover chicken can be added to the broth to save time.
→ Is there a vegetarian version of this soup?
You can substitute chicken with tofu and use vegetable broth instead.
→ How can I make this soup less spicy?
Reduce the number of chilies or remove the seeds from the chilies before adding them.
→ Can I freeze this soup?
Yes, you can freeze it, but it's best to add fresh cilantro just before serving after thawing.
